Transaction 496d91ff6638f74ff4532ad628e958b82c3e9d58c9089076a4b8487de3a45cb2

1 Input
2 Outputs
  • 496d91ff6638f74ff4532ad628e958b82c3e9d58c9089076a4b8487de3a45cb2:0
  • value  15297759
    address  34XrTGTGs3EuDm1xwoJ9CXF6SrEPELQjNU
  • 496d91ff6638f74ff4532ad628e958b82c3e9d58c9089076a4b8487de3a45cb2:1
  • value  2044544
    address  3Dxb7sUEk3cFyCr9A4s1GgtEuNKBWsyKP9